Level 3 Communications Assigned Patent
Storing content items in secondary storage
By Francis Pelletier | November 11, 2022 at 2:00 pmLevel 3 Communications, LLC, Broomfield, CO, has been assigned a patent (11463520) developed by Crowder, William, Camarillo, CA, for “systems and methods for storing content items in secondary storage.“
The abstract of the patent published by the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office states: “Examples described herein relate to systems and methods for storing content items. The methods may be implemented by a computer comprising a processor, primary storage device, secondary storage, device and network interface. The primary storage device may receive, via the network interface, a plurality of content items responsive to respective requests from clients. The plurality of content items may be distributed, via the network interface, from the primary storage device to clients responsive to the respective requests from the clients. The processor may generate a dynamic priority list for the content items based on the respective requests from the clients over time, and may write, based on the dynamic priority list, only a subset of the content items to the secondary storage device.”
The patent application was filed on 2020-04-27 (16/859918).
